Job Overview

Atrius Health, an innovative healthcare leader, provides connected care for over 690,000 patients across 30 locations in eastern Massachusetts. Our team of 645 physicians and 420 clinicians collaborates closely with hospitals, specialists, and nursing facilities. Our mission is to transform care to improve lives by delivering high-quality, patient-centered, coordinated, and cost-effective care. We prioritize shared decision-making, understanding, and trust to enhance health and well-being. Atrius Health is part of Optum, focusing on building a leading value-based care system.

Responsibilities
  • Assist clinicians with routine clinical procedures and tests in the exam room.
  • Advise patients on preparation and testing requirements for exams.
  • Complete all pre-visit work and ensure lab and test results are available in the EMR.
  • Deliver excellent customer service and strengthen patient/clinician relationships through timely, informative interactions.
  • Improve clinical operations by ensuring efficient patient flow.
  • Provide clinical and clerical support related to patient care.
  • Support one or more clinicians directly as needed.
Qualifications
  • High School diploma or equivalent (GED, HiSET, TASC).
  • Medical Assistant Certification required; associate degree or completion of a medical assistant program preferred.
  • American Heart Association BLS certification strongly preferred; ACLS may be required based on specialty.
Experience & Skills
  • Minimum one year of clinical or customer service experience; degree may substitute for experience.
  • Computer proficiency, including word processing and spreadsheets.
  • EMR experience or aptitude required.
  • Professional communication, interpersonal, customer service, time management, and organizational skills.
  • Ability to prioritize tasks in a busy environment.
